Inclusive practice and equalities bibliography

  • Borkett, P. (2018). Cultural Diversity and Inclusion in Early Years Education. London. Routledge.
  • Borkett, P. (2021). Special Educational Needs in the Early Years – A guide to inclusive practice. London. Sage.
  • Department for Education and Department of Health (2015) Special educational needs and disability code of practice: 0 to 25 years.
  • Freire, P (1970) Pedagogy of the oppressed. New York. Herder and Herder
  • González, N., Moll, L. C. and Amanti, C., eds.(2005) Funds of Knowledge: Theorizing Practices in Households, Communities and Classrooms, Mahwah, NJ: Lawrence Erlbaum.
  • HM Government (2010) The Equality Act.
  • Houston, G. (2018) Racialisation in Early Years Education: Black Children’s Stories from the Classroom.
  • Kilvington, J. and Wood, A. (2016) Gender, Sex and Children’s Play. Bloomsbury
  • Levitas, R. Pantazis, C. Fahmy, E. Gordon, D. Lloyd, E. Patsios, D. (2007) The Multidimensional analysis of social exclusion. University of Bristol
  • Martin, B. (2011) Children at Play: Learning Gender in the Early Years. Stoke on Trent: Trentham Books
  • Metzler, M. Merrick, M.T., Klevens, J. Ports, K.A. Ford, D.C. (2017) Adverse childhood experiences and life opportunities: Shifting the narrative. Children and Youth Services Review, 72. pp. 141-149
  • Pascal and Bertram (2016) High Achieving White Working Class (HAWWC) Boys Project. Final Report. Centre for Research in Early Childhood.
  • Price, D. (2018) A Practical Guide to Gender diversity and sexuality in the early years. London: JKP.
  • Simpson, D (2013) Remediating child poverty via preschool: exploring practitioners’ perspectives in England. (In International Journal of Early Years Education 21:1 pp85-96) Routledge.
  • Smidt, S. (2020) Creating an Anti-Racist Culture in the Early Years: An Essential Guide for Practitioners.
  • Tembo, S. (2020) Black educators in (white) settings: Making racial identity visible in Early Childhood Education and Care in England, UK. Journal of Early Childhood Research.
  • UNHCR Refugee Agency (2010) Article 1 in Convention and protocol relating to the status of refugees. Geneva. UNHCR Communications and Public Information Service. United Nation Convention on the Rights of the Child. (1991) Article 12.
